Brooke Ligertwood
Obviously, I’m pretty biased here – the 000-28 Brooke Ligertwood signature edition is my favorite. I created my dream guitar – a combination of my favorite parts of what had been my two favorite guitars in my collection – my PS2 Paul Simon and my Eric Clapton signature editions. The additional feature I love that isn’t part of either of those aforementioned guitars is the flamed maple we used inside the body. It really makes a difference to the volume and resonance you’re able to get out of that same body shape.

Mary Spender
I’m just head over heels in love with my OM-28. I had lusted after Martins for a long time but never had the opportunity to buy my own. A few years ago, I went into my local guitar store in Brighton in the U.K. They had an OM-28 on show, I played it, and it was the most comfortable guitar I’d ever held. The connection was instant. The neck profile, the body size, everything just fit me so perfectly. It also sounded incredible, so rich and full. I knew I had to have it. We’ve been together four years now – it's hands down my favorite instrument I’ve ever owned.
